In the name of Allah, the Merciful, the Compassionate Surah: Al-Baqara Ayahs: 135-141 http://al-islamforall.org/quran/Imgarabic/p01/a21.gif http://al-islamforall.org/quran/Imgurdu/p01/a21.gif English Translation by Abdullah Yusuf Ali 2:135 They say: "Become Jews or Christians if ye would be guided (To salvation)." Say thou: "Nay! (I would rather) the Religion of Abraham the True, and he joined not gods with Allah." 2:136 Say ye: "We believe in Allah, and the revelation given to us, and to Abraham, Isma'il, Isaac, Jacob, and the Tribes, and that given to Moses and Jesus, and that given to (all) prophets from their Lord: We make no difference between one and another of them: And we bow to Allah (in Islam)." 2:137 So if they believe as ye believe, they are indeed on the right path; but if they turn back, it is they who are in schism; but Allah will suffice thee as against them, and He is the All-Hearing, the All-Knowing. 2:138 (Our religion is) the Baptism of Allah: And who can baptize better than Allah? And it is He Whom we worship. 2:139 Say: Will ye dispute with us about Allah, seeing that He is our Lord and your Lord; that we are responsible for our doings and ye for yours; and that We are sincere (in our faith) in Him? 2:140 Or do ye say that Abraham, Isma'il Isaac, Jacob and the Tribes were Jews or Christians? Say: Do ye know better than Allah? Ah! who is more unjust than those who conceal the testimony they have from Allah? but Allah is not unmindful of what ye do! 2:141 That was a people that hath passed away. They shall reap the fruit of what they did, and ye of what ye do!
